Founded in 1987, Vi is a senior living operator focused on luxury Life Plan Communities that combine residential living, hospitality, wellness, and access to a continuum of care within a single community setting. The company positions itself around high-end retirement living, emphasizing independent lifestyles, dining, programming, social engagement, and resident support services for older adults. Its operating model aligns most closely with continuing care retirement community services rather than traditional hospitality or standalone real estate, given the integrated care component and service structure described on its website.

Founded in 1982, Griswold Home Care helps adults maintain quality of life despite advanced age or onset of illness through services including companion care, home services, personal care, and respite care.

NTUC Health is a comprehensive provider of health and elderly care services in Singapore, offering a wide range of solutions including nursing homes, senior day care, home care, and rehabilitation services. The company focuses on active ageing, providing fitness programs and community support to keep seniors engaged and healthy. With a commitment to quality care, NTUC Health also operates a family medicine clinic to manage chronic illnesses and provide preventive care. Their services are designed for seniors and their caregivers, ensuring peace of mind and support for families.

Founded in 1999, Integrated Living is provider of health services throughout rural, regional and remote communities of Australia. Integrated Living is headquartered in New South Wales, Australia.
